WebSep 12, 2024 · Calculate the energy used during the year for each bulb, using E = P t. Multiply the energy by the cost. Solution Calculate the power for each bulb. (9.6.13) E I n c a n d e s c e n t = P t = 100 W ( 1 k W 1000 W) ( 3 h d a y) ( 365 d a y s) = 109.5 k W ⋅ h (9.6.14) E L E D = P t = 20 W ( 1 k W 1000 W) ( 3 h d a y) ( 365 d a y s) = 21.9 k W ⋅ h WebSimply take your current incandescent watts and select the corresponding LED bulb equivalent on the lumens brightness scale. WebBulbs with an output of 3500K or lower on the scale will have an amber hue. Bulbs in the mid-range of 3500K-4100K will have a white hue. Bulbs in the higher 4200K+ range will tend to have more of a blue hue closer to, or exceeding, that of sunlight. WebJan 14, 2016 · The emission spectrum for natural light generally follows the Planck distribution in the visible part of the spectrum, as we can see below. No color is dramatically favored over another, although the intensity is highest in the light blue region, around 460 nm. The emission spectrum of visible light arriving at the earth’s surface from the sun.
